Summer Stars (www.summerstars.org), one of the largest non-profit summer programs in the country, works each year to send hundreds of urban youth to a free, ten-day performing arts and music education excursion. Founded in 1999 as the Britney Spears Camp for the Performing Arts, and later the American Idol Camp, Summer Stars was renamed in 2006 as the leading non-profit summer arts program in the country.
